David's Thirty Fighting Men

29 Heleb the son of Baanah an Netophathite; Ittai the son of Ribai of Gibeah, a city of the children of Benjamin; 30 Benaiah the Pirathonite; Hiddai of the river of Gaash; 31 Abialbon the Arbathite; Azmaveth a Barhumite;
